Bachelors Thesis
Developing a method to evaluate the non-linear effects and the behaviour in saturation of
power inductors used as a reference impedances for flicker measurements according to EN 61000-3-3
In my bachelors thesis I developed a method to characterize high value power inductors in a simple and precise way.
This thesis was made in cooperation with ZES ZIMMER Electronic Systems GmbH, who providing the neccessary equipment and helped in questions regarding the measurement procedure.

74141-e - A simple replacement for an old IC
This is a small project which was done basically out of curiosity.
I didn't have enough 74141 Nixie driver ICs in the lab to rebuild a vintage piece of metrology equipment, which is why I decided to just try and create a simple component that can mimic the features of the 74141 and 7441A out of modern SMD components, with the goal to have a pin compatible drop in replacement.

20Arms mains inrush current limiter with various safety features
I needed a way to limit the inrush current of my 5kVA isolation transformer, which is why I developed this inrush current limiter which is capable of 20Arms continuous.
It is designed for easy assemble as a DIY kit and uses a low BOM count to keep costs down.
